We have an opening for an Alarms Deferred Maintenance Supervisor to supervise and coordinate a skilled trades crew engaged in the installation, repair, fabrication, operation, and maintenance of fire alarms and emergency voice alarm systems, emergency lights and sprinkler systems in support of the Laboratory's Fire and Alarms Life Safety Systems and Infrastructure. You will provide advanced technical support, solve complex technical problems, and exercise advanced decision-making utilizing and adhering to established guidelines and procedures. This position is in the Emergency Management Department, Alarms Division. This position may require work at Site 300 located in Tracy, California. You will Provide supervision and leadership to coordinate a skilled trades crew engaged in the installation, repair, fabrication, operation and maintenance of site-wide fire alarms and emergency voice alarm systems, emergency lights and sprinkler systems, including set work priorities and schedule work assignments, oversee Deferred Maintenance budget, train staff, resolve personnel issues, and complete performance appraisals. Oversee and ensure major modifications, maintenance, repair, and regulatory compliance of specialized Life Safety Systems, computer-controlled interfaces, specialized detection systems, fire alarm and fan control panels, fire suppression systems, emergency and general use voice systems, criticality alarms systems and refrigerant/oxygen monitors, emergency lights and sprinkler systems, including Fire and Emergency Voice Alarm design controls, engineering planning and decision process. Lead the set up and operation of intricate systems and electronic equipment such as fire alarm and emergency voice paging systems, emergency lights and sprinkler systems, refrigerant monitors, and data gathering panels in accordance with established program procedures. Interpret specifications from complex technical blueprints, diagrams, specifications, software and system programs, schematics, and operation/product manuals, and utilize standard electrician and maintenance technician tools of the trade. Provide in-depth analysis and evaluation of complex technical electronics data utilizing computer-based data acquisition and controls to report results, evaluate test procedures, determine circuit requirements, establish guidelines, and develop applications software. Analyze data, prepare, and present project estimates, technical and supervisory reports, including review, interpret, write, and document Fire and Alarms Life Safety Systems test results to identify and resolve complex technical problems, report results, and recommend solutions. Ensure regulatory compliance with federal, state, National Fire Protection Association (NFPA) codes and standards, including ES&H, safety, security, program, and Laboratory policies and personnel procedures. Interact with facility and program managers, senior management, inspectors, ES&H technicians, contractors, other crafts personnel, technical and administrative personnel, vendors, and act as point of contact for regulatory agencies. Flexible Benefits Package 401(k) Relocation Assistance Education Reimbursement Program Flexible schedules (*depending on project needs) Inclusion, Diversity, Equity and Accountability (IDEA) - visit Our core beliefs - visit Employee engagement - visit Site 300 Site 300 is an experimental test site operated by LLNL. Situated on 7,000 acres in rural foothills approximately six miles southwest of downtown Tracy and 15 miles southeast of Livermore, Site 300 hosts approximately 200 employees with expertise in such fields as engineering, chemistry, biology, and environmental restoration. Employees assigned to work at Site 300 may be exposed to the organism that causes San Joaquin Valley Fever (coccidioidomycosis).
